I hear ya on the being scared of math thing, but the only thing you can do is try to put the fear aside and focus on what you need to do. First thing is to check out the program requirements - what math pre-req is required for entrance into the chem you need to take? Then go take the math placement test to see where you stand. Then you just start going step by step to get where you need to go.

Don't let your fear get the better of you. I'm sure your college has tutoring available - take advantage of it! Very basic algebra. You can also get through it with an understanding of how to set up and solve problems involving ratios which is under the realm of pre-algebra. However, you should have basic algebra to be on the safe side.
